33,533,610 is a composite number, even.
33,533,610 (thirty-three million five hundred thirty-three thousand six hundred ten) is an even 8-digit number. It is a composite number with 64 divisors, and factors as 2 × 3 × 5 × 11 × 307 × 331. Its proper divisors sum to 54,815,574,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1FFAEAA.
